Thread: How is the Khitai grind?

  1. #1

    Default How is the Khitai grind?

    So I just recently got my DT to 80 and decided I'd level up his Armorsmithing so that Khitai wouldn't immediately kick my ass.

    That said, I remember from when the expansion first came out that the faction grind was absolutely awful, but I've heard it's gotten better.
    My question is just how much better? Months turned to weeks?

    Thanks

    MoA reward have been greatly increased, but also the cooldown for the quest, I think.

    So it do feels "less grindy", because you will have to repeat the same quest less time than before. However, if you were the kind of guy to mindlessly grind for hours, you might feel that it doesn't especially take less time to become rank 4 of faction. (because of the cooldown)

    But personally I find it more enjoyable, and quick enough. However, certain faction are really easy to grind (Wolves, Hyrkanian) because quests are easy, all located in the same place (which is also the easy place of the khitai to grind) and the rewards are more important.

    If you'll join all factions, you can get blue faction pants in about 1h. IIRC you'll get MoAs faster than rank and gold, so you'll have to run some insignia quests or HMs to not get stuck. Also - start doing solo dungeons ASAP for rares.

    Keep in mind that you'll get a free armor piece if you gain new rank (excluding Wolves, Tigers, Hyrkanians and Scholars).

    Training armorsmith is nonsense:

    1) blue faction gear is comparable to the best crafted armor

    2) it takes a lot of time, effort and luck to be able to craft the best blue armours

    3) chances are you'll drop better (epic) armour on the first day you'll start doing HMs

    4) crafting will be wiped and you may not be reimbursed properly when new system will go live

    It has not changed much. Yes, you can do solo dungeons for rares but to purchase faction epics you need lots of them. Combine factions quests and HMs, do solo dungeons and grind for rares (Adashir Fort in Turan gives 10+ rares in 30 min. with a decent group).

    I remember lively the KK grind for epic pants doing Yag again and again.... Luckily there is an alternative for epic pants: Ai District.

    And, as it has been said already, forget crafting. It's hard to grind for nice recipes and what you can craft is, in general, not better than the Khitai gear. More important, with the upcoming changes of the crafting system all you efforts will be in vain.
